Diagnostics of the current network state
The first step is always an objective assessment of the situation. Don't rely on subjective impressions of "slow loading," as this doesn't provide accurate data for analysis. Speed measurements should be taken using specialized services, such as speedtest.net or the provider's official tester.
It's important to test on different devices and at different distances from the access point. This will help determine whether the problem lies with the connection itself or with a specific device. If the speed matches the plan on a cable connection, but drops significantly over the air, the issue is local and solvable.
Pay attention to the ping and jitter indicators, which are also displayed during testing. A high ping may indicate channel congestion or issues with your ISP, even if your download speed is technically high.
- 📊 Run a speed test via an Ethernet cable to capture reference values.
- 📡 Check the signal strength at different distances from the router.
- 📱 Compare results on your smartphone, laptop, and tablet.
- 🔄 Reboot the equipment and repeat the measurements to rule out temporary failures.
⚠️ Please note: Test results may vary significantly depending on the time of day. In the evening, when the load on the provider's network is at its highest, speeds may naturally drop.
After collecting the initial data, you can move on to analyzing the equipment settings. Often, the factory-set default parameters are not optimal for the specific conditions of your home.
Optimizing router placement
The physical location of the router plays a critical role in signal distribution. Radio waves penetrate poorly through solid walls, mirrors, aquariums, and household appliances. The ideal location is considered to be the center of the apartment, located at a high altitude.
It's not recommended to hide the router in cabinets, behind a TV, or in alcoves. Metal surfaces and dense furniture will block the signal, creating "dead zones." If moving the device to the center of the room isn't possible, at least try to clear the space around the antennas.
It's also worth considering the influence of neighboring networks. In apartment buildings, the airwaves are clogged with dozens of signals, which can cause interference. Placing the router away from windows facing neighbors can sometimes help reduce noise levels.
The device's antennas should be oriented vertically. If the antennas are removable and can be replaced with more powerful ones, this is a great investment for improving coverage.
Setting up the frequency range and channels
Modern routers Rostelecom Often support two bands: 2.4 GHz and 5 GHz. The former has a longer range, but is slower and more noisy. The latter offers higher speeds but has a shorter range and is less effective at penetrating walls.
For devices that require high bandwidth (TVs, gaming consoles, laptops), it is highly recommended to use the range 5 GHzThis will avoid conflicts with microwave ovens and Bluetooth devices operating at 2.4 GHz.
In your router settings, select the least congested channel. Automatic selection doesn't always work correctly, so it's best to manually scan the airwaves and locate a clear frequency.
To configure the settings, log into the router's web interface. The address is usually located on a sticker on the bottom of the device, often 192.168.1.1 or 192.168.0.1The login and password are also on the label.
Path to settings: WLAN -> Basic -> Channel Width (for 2.4 GHz set to 20 MHz, for 5 GHz - 80 MHz)
Channel width also affects speed. In the 2.4 GHz band, 20 MHz is best for stability, while in the 5 GHz band, 80 MHz is safe for maximum performance.
Firmware update and factory reset
Router software, or firmware, controls all data transfer processes. Manufacturers regularly release updates that fix bugs and improve stable operation. An outdated version can cause intermittent connection interruptions.
You can check for a new version in your user account or directly in the router interface. Some models RT-com support automatic updates, which is the most convenient option.
If your router has been running slowly for a long time, a full factory reset may help. This will clear accumulated software junk and restore the configuration to its original state.

⚠️ Please note: When resetting your settings, you will lose all user settings, including Wi-Fi passwords and PPPoE login information. Please write down your internet connection information in advance.
After the reset, you'll need to reconfigure your internet connection. Enter the login and password provided by your ISP and configure new security settings for your wireless network.
Comparison of Wi-Fi standards characteristics
Understanding the differences between wireless standards will help you properly assess the capabilities of your equipment. Older devices may not physically support the high speeds available with modern plans.
The table below compares the key features of popular standards to help you determine whether you should consider replacing your router.
| Standard | Max. speed (theoret.) | Range | Stability |
|---|---|---|---|
| 802.11n | up to 600 Mbps | 2.4 / 5 GHz | Average |
| 802.11ac | up to 6.9 Gbps | 5 GHz | High |
| 802.11ax | up to 9.6 Gbps | 2.4 / 5 / 6 GHz | Very high |
| 802.11g | up to 54 Mbps | 2.4 GHz | Low |
If your router only supports the standard 802.11g or nIf the plan offers speeds above 100 Mbps, equipment replacement will become mandatory. Without this, the bottleneck will not be eliminated.
Modern models from Rostelecom, such as the series RT-XX, are already equipped with support for current standards. When renting equipment from a provider, you can request a replacement for your old device.
Safety as a factor of speed
Slow speeds are often caused by unauthorized access to your network. If your password is weak or missing, neighbors can use your bandwidth to download large files or watch 4K videos.
Check the list of connected clients in the router's web interface. If you see unfamiliar devices, change the password and encryption type immediately. It is recommended to use only WPA2-PSK or WPA3.
Disable the feature WPS, as it contains vulnerabilities that make it easy to hack the network. It's also helpful to hide the network name (SSID) if you want to limit the number of devices that can connect.
How to create a strong password?
Use a combination of uppercase and lowercase letters, numbers, and special characters. The password must be at least 12 characters long. Avoid using birthdays or simple sequences.
Regularly changing your password and monitoring connected devices will help keep your network clean and fast. This is especially important in densely populated areas where your network's range may reach neighboring houses.
Using repeaters and mesh systems
In large apartments or houses with thick walls, a single router may not be enough. The signal weakens before reaching distant rooms. In such cases, signal repeaters or mesh systems come to the rescue.
A repeater receives the signal from the main router and broadcasts it further. However, it's important to keep in mind that it cuts the speed by approximately half, as it operates in half-duplex mode. Mesh systems eliminate this drawback and create a single, seamless network.
For subscribers Rostelecom Ready-made solutions for expanding coverage are available. Engineers can install additional access points that will synchronize with the main gateway.
When choosing expansion equipment, make sure it's compatible with your main router. Ideally, use devices from the same manufacturer and series.
Why does Wi-Fi speed drop in the evening?
In the evening, the load on provider equipment and the communication channels themselves in apartment buildings increases. Multiple users access the network simultaneously, leading to congestion and a reduction in the available bandwidth for each subscriber.
Does the number of connected devices affect the speed?
Yes, it does. The router distributes bandwidth among all active clients. If one user is downloading torrents, others may have difficulty loading even simple web pages.
Should I turn off my router at night?
Modern equipment is designed to operate 24/7. Frequent switching on and off can even shorten the lifespan of the device. However, periodic reboots (once a week) are useful for clearing RAM.
